Heat pump problems in Evergreen's semi-arid climate can affect both heating and cooling. Here are the most common issues HVAC professionals diagnose when Evergreen homeowners call for heat pump service.
A heat pump blowing cool air in heating mode in Evergreen often points to thermostat settings, reversing valve issues, low refrigerant, or normal defrost behavior — proper diagnosis determines the fix.
Heat pump icing in Evergreen's semi-arid climate requires careful diagnosis. Normal defrost cycles vs. malfunction require different responses — technicians determine which applies.
Frequent on/off cycling can be caused by sensors, airflow problems, thermostat placement, or electrical component failures.
Dirty filters, blower issues, duct restrictions, or coil buildup can limit airflow and reduce both heating and cooling output.
A heat pump that won't start in Evergreen requires systematic checks of breakers, capacitors, contactors, control boards, and safety switches to identify the cause.
Incorrect charge, dirty coils, duct leakage, or auxiliary heat running too often can increase costs. Maintenance can help.

Heat pump solutions in Evergreen, CO typically include troubleshooting, repairs, seasonal tune-ups, airflow improvements, and replacement guidance. Because heat pumps provide both heating and cooling, a technician checks refrigerant performance, electrical components, controls, and defrost operation to restore comfort.
A heat pump may struggle due to thermostat settings, airflow restrictions, low refrigerant, electrical failures, or a reversing valve or control issue. A professional can diagnose the system and recommend the right heat pump solution in Evergreen, CO based on the root cause.
Light frost can be normal in cold weather, but heavy ice buildup may indicate a defrost problem, airflow blockage, or refrigerant performance issue. If icing is persistent in Evergreen, schedule service so a technician can correct the issue safely and prevent damage.
Because heat pumps run year-round, many Evergreen homeowners schedule maintenance twice a year — before peak heating and before peak cooling. Preventive heat pump solutions in Evergreen, CO include cleaning coils, checking airflow, and verifying controls and refrigerant performance.
Repair vs. replacement depends on age, efficiency, comfort issues, and the cost of the repair. If your heat pump needs frequent service or can't keep up with weather extremes in Evergreen, a contractor can compare repair options to modern high-efficiency replacements.
Often, yes. Heat pumps can be highly efficient when correctly sized and installed, and when ducts and airflow are in good shape. An HVAC pro can review your current system and recommend heat pump solutions in Evergreen, CO that improve comfort and reduce wasted energy.
Most heat pump service calls in Evergreen take one to three hours depending on the issue. Electrical repairs and defrost diagnostics often take under two hours, while refrigerant work or coil cleaning may take longer. Your contractor will give you a realistic estimate before starting.
